How do we self-enhance?
-
Self- serving bias- This is any cognitive or perceptual process that is distorted by the need to
maintain and enhance self-esteem, or the tendency to perceive yourself in an overly favourable
manner. In other words, individuals tend to ascribe success to their own abilities and efforts, but
ascribe failure to external factors (they reject the validity of negative feedback in order to
protect their ego from threat/injury). The use of self-serving biases becomes stronger when
failure is made public (visible to others).
We are critical about information we gain.
We spend time on processing positive and negative feedback from others in order to make
changes to ourselves.
We forget failure feedback forgetting our past failures to self enhance
The self-fulfilling prophecy has a great impact on shaping our self-concept. The self-fulfilling prophecy is
a prediction that directly or indirectly causes itself to become true by the very terms of the prophecy
itself, due to positive feedback between belief and behaviour an expectation about a subject (e.g. a
person or event) can affect our behaviour towards that subject, which causes the expectation to occur.
e.g. lets say youre starting a new job but youve never done that type of work before. You may have a
strong belief that you cant handle the responsibilities of the job and therefore make negative
statements towards yourself about the work you are doing. As a result, this has a negative impact on
your work performance, and your negative expectations have affected your behaviour to the point
where your original prediction becomes true. Because of this, we believe that our prediction must have
been correct which only encourages our confidence of inadequacy in future predictions. To actually take
